The initial mass of the rocket is m₀ = 200 g, the mass of the charge is m = 180 g, the initial velocity of the rocket is zero, the relative exit velocity of the combustion products of the nozzle is u = 30 m / s. Neglecting air resistance and the acceleration of free fall, find the speed of the rocket at the time of full charge burnout.
